Specialized brain injury rehabilitation

  • Toronto Rehab’s Neuro Rehab Program, which comprises the Brain Injury Service, is Canada’s largest rehabilitation program for adults who have suffered a brain injury, stroke or other neurological condition. This magnitude gives Toronto Rehab an unparalleled wealth of experience treating patients with brain injuries and helping them rebuild their lives.
  • This experience, combined with its range of patient care programming, position Toronto Rehab uniquely to manage co-morbidities that are common in brain injured patients, such as spinal cord or peripheral nerve injuries.
  • Separate streams of care for patients whose injuries and impairments are more cognitive or physical, staffed by separate expert teams of health care professionals, make Toronto Rehab’s rehabilitation services exceptionally specialized.
  • Inpatient services are delivered within a secure facility to safeguard individuals who may be at risk of wandering.
  • Special assessments, treatment and education are available to individuals with multiple sclerosis.
  • An interprofessional team of clinician-scientists who are trained in a wide range of physical, cognitive, behavioural and emotional conditions and issues related to brain injury delivers rehab treatment. This breadth enables far more comprehensive care than the standard combination of occupational therapy and physiotherapy. In addition to their own specialties, all team members are trained in other critical skills, such as managing confused and restless behaviour. Toronto Rehab uses a physiatrist-led interprofessional approach to care from assessment to discharge.
  • Toronto Rehab played a leadership role in the development of the national specialty certification in rehabilitation nursing and has several certified rehabilitation nurses on staff.
  • The hospital’s range of programming and its many productive professional partnerships facilitate timely, streamlined access to additional specialty physicians, as necessary.
  • The Chronic Pain Service provides treatment and education and is available to individuals with fibromyalgia and other types of pain.
